From: Hubert Tong Date: Sat, 23 Mar 2019 18:10:45 +0000 (+0000) Subject: libclang/CIndexer.cpp: Use loadquery() on AIX for path to library X-Git-Tag: llvmorg-10-init~9308 X-Git-Url: http://review.tizen.org/git/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=a7510baf8477c370a9710a52c7de09a8d4a5396d;p=platform%2Fupstream%2Fllvm.git libclang/CIndexer.cpp: Use loadquery() on AIX for path to library Summary: `dladdr` is not available on AIX. Similar functionality is presented through `loadquery`. This patch replaces a use of `dladdr` with a version based on `loadquery`.
